Asks why we have preconceived notions of the middle east without having been there. The way the west looks at the countries of the middle east is driven by bias and distorts the actual way they actually live. Wrote the history of how the arab was/is presented through art and literature. The idea that all people from the east are essentially the same, no matter which country they"re from. Britain and france directly occupied the middle east. The us did not have such a close relationship with them. Their ideas were more like abstractions and were highly politicized. Portrayal of arabs as violent and irrational based on constant presentation of terrorists and wars. Journalists present muslims as fundamental terrorists, but do not do the same with bombings performed by christians. Films portray muslims as a lesser breed that are evil and only resort to violence.
